Well, yes and no. A while ago Mark Templin made comments about how a good chunk of GX owners use their 'utes for towing, off road, and recreational use so with everyone else going to unibody platforms, the GX gave Lexus a unique hold on the market.
I have no idea why they are aiming this commercial at soccer moms when they already know their core competency does not appeal to that crowd. They are probably doing it to try to broaden appeal and reach out to a consumer who may not have thought of the GX before, but why did they do it in a commercial fit for a CRV or Rav4?
There is absolutely nothing about that ad that says "Lexus" or "luxury" or "expensive" or "$60K luxury SUV". Nothing. Lexus has long been heralded as having some of the highest quality ads but this one honestly looks fit for an econo car. Not to mention, I know they changed voices a while ago but this ad doesn't even have the new guy.
I am all about them trying new stuff and going in a new direction, but at least try to make sure it well-represents the product and the company. The concept for this commercial would have been right for a Fit, or a Tucson, or a Sienna or something, NOT a $60,000 luxury SUV.
